Заглавная страница Избранные статьи Случайная статья Познавательные статьи Новые добавления Обратная связь КАТЕГОРИИ: АрхеологияБиология Генетика География Информатика История Логика Маркетинг Математика Менеджмент Механика Педагогика Религия Социология Технологии Физика Философия Финансы Химия Экология ТОП 10 на сайте Приготовление дезинфицирующих растворов различной концентрацииТехника нижней прямой подачи мяча. Франко-прусская война (причины и последствия) Организация работы процедурного кабинета Смысловое и механическое запоминание, их место и роль в усвоении знаний Коммуникативные барьеры и пути их преодоления Обработка изделий медицинского назначения многократного применения Образцы текста публицистического стиля Четыре типа изменения баланса Задачи с ответами для Всероссийской олимпиады по праву Мы поможем в написании ваших работ! ЗНАЕТЕ ЛИ ВЫ?
Влияние общества на человека
Приготовление дезинфицирующих растворов различной концентрации Практические работы по географии для 6 класса Организация работы процедурного кабинета Изменения в неживой природе осенью Уборка процедурного кабинета Сольфеджио. Все правила по сольфеджио Балочные системы. Определение реакций опор и моментов защемления |
Концептуальная модель и ее описание
На этапе анализа необходимо подробное исследование как будущих функциональных возможностей разрабатываемой системы, так и информации, необходимой для их выполнения. Поэтому особое внимание было уделено как полноте информации, так и поиску противоречивой, дублирующей или неиспользуемой информации. Каждая сущность имеет неограниченное количество атрибутов, но, проанализировав требования к системе и осуществив детализацию хранилищ данных, будущую модель можно представить в виде связанных между собой отношениями сущностей. Проведя анализ предметной области путем изучения вышеперечисленной информации, были выявлены следующие внешние сущности: - Заказчик, лицо желающее получить строительные услуги; - Подрядчик, лицо предоставляющее строительные услуги; - Поставщик материалов, лицо, обязующееся поставлять материалы на строительство. - Договор, документ, регламентирующий отношения между подрядчиком, заказчиком и поставщиком материалов. - Смета, документ, определяющий стоимость работ по договору. Накопителями данных являются: - информация о заказчиках; - информация о подрядчиках; - информация о поставщиках материалов; - информация о договорах; - информация о проектно-сметной документации Информационная система разбита на четыре логические подсистемы: - система формирования и редактирования исходных данных; - система запросов; - система формирование отчетов; - система анализа данных.
Рис. 3. Концептуальная модель
На основе проведения анализа предметной области, концептуальной модели, информационных потоков предприятия можно построить схему потоков данных, где определены основные потоки: 1,4,5 – формирование справочника заказчики; 4,2,6 – формирование справочника поставщики; 3,4,7 – формирование справочника подрядчики; 4,11,9 – формирование данных по договору с заказчиками Рис.4. Схема потоков данных
12,4,9 – формирование данных по договору с подрядчиками 4,13,9 – формирование данных по договору с поставщиками 4,10 – формирование справочника ответственное лицо 4,11,12,9 – формирование учетных данных по договору с заказчиками 4,12,14,9 - формирование учетных данных по договору с подрядчиками 4,14,13,9 - формирование учетных данных по договору с поставщиками
17,15 – формирование запрос а по менеджерам 16,18,15 - 18,19,20,15 – формирование запроса по суммам договоров подрядчиков 21,19,18,15 – формирование запроса по заказчикам, договорам, сметам; 22,23,24,15 – формирование отчета по заказчикам, договорам, сметем; 25,26 – аналитический отчет 27,28 - отчет по подрядчикам 29,27 - отчет по поставщикам материалов 26,27 - отчет по отелу договоров Полученная модель данных графически представлена инфологической моделью рис 5. Рис.5. Инфологическая модель данных
Датологическая модель (рис.6) строится на основе разработанной инфологической модели и наиболее приемлемой для дальнейшей разработки является реляционная модель данных, где вся информация хранится в виде связанных таблиц, что дает возможность более эффективно хранить информацию, сохраняя целостность данных. Между таблицами устанавливаются отношения «один-ко-многим». Это самый распространенный вид отношений в реляционной базе данных.
|
|||||
Последнее изменение этой страницы: 2020-03-14; просмотров: 167; Нарушение авторского права страницы; Мы поможем в написании вашей работы! inf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 3.145.9.181 (0.006 с.) |